Output 4fa8a3a6bee5d26b5d5043120615900d13c1eb1bc3147439cbcfd3baecf4cefa:11

value
137759
script pubkey
OP_HASH160 OP_PUSHBYTES_20 469b04a9fa9981b3d47cae42a0eb19bff3fc3ae7 OP_EQUAL
address
388Lvptjyhzx2eefjcqdVVGzWPQGkxAy2x
transaction
4fa8a3a6bee5d26b5d5043120615900d13c1eb1bc3147439cbcfd3baecf4cefa
confirmations
293553
spent
true